Q: Is 261,558 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 261,558 is not a prime number.

Why is 261,558 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 261558 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 11 18 22 33 66 99 198 1,321 2,642 3,963 7,926 11,889 14,531 23,778 29,062 43,593 87,186 130,779 and 261,558, with no remainder.

Since 261,558 cannot be divided by just 1 and 261,558, it is not a prime number.
